Packing and Inventory Management

Organizing packing and inventory is crucial. Labeling each box with its contents and destination can prevent confusion. Creating a detailed inventory list helps track items and ensures nothing is lost.

Fragile items should be packed with care using bubble wrap or packing paper. Computers, printers, and other electronics should be backed up and packed securely. Special handling is often required for these valuable items to avoid damage.

Using a color-coded system for different departments can make unpacking easier. Some companies use software to keep track of inventory during the move. This allows quick access to essential items in the new office.

Hiring Professional Movers

Professional movers specialize in office relocations. They provide packing materials, load items, and transport them safely. Choosing a reputable company is important. Look for ones with experience in office moves, good reviews, and proper insurance to cover any damages.

Scheduling the move during off-peak hours can reduce disruptions. Movers should be briefed on the layout of the new office to unload boxes directly to their destinations. This minimizes extra handling.

Cost is a factor, so getting quotes from multiple movers can help budget planning. Confirm the moving date and communicate any special requirements or concerns to the movers ahead of time.

Identifying Potential Risks When Moving Office

Identifying potential risks is the first step in planning a successful office move. This involves recognizing budget overruns, logistical issues, and communication breakdowns. Organizations should also be aware of unforeseen costs that might arise during the process. To mitigate these risks, companies can create a risk assessment matrix. This tool helps catalog potential problems and determine their probability and impact. Regular updates and reviews of the matrix keep the moving plan flexible and responsive to any issues that may surface.

Ensuring Asset Security

Securing assets during relocation is vital to prevent loss or damage. This includes data, equipment, and furniture. Companies need to implement robust security measures, such as employing trusted moving companies and using secure packaging for sensitive items. Digital assets, such as client information and internal data, should be backed up and transferred securely. Tools like data encryption can provide extra protection. Detailed inventories and labeling of all items can further ensure nothing is misplaced or stolen. Regularly monitoring the move and conducting checks before and after transport can provide additional security assurance.

Packing Strategies and Materials

Begin packing non-essential items several weeks before the move. Use sturdy boxes, bubble wrap, packing paper, and tape to secure belongings. Label each box clearly with its contents and the room it belongs to. This makes unpacking much easier.

Consider a packing timeline. Start with rarely used items and progress to daily essentials closer to moving day. For fragile items, use extra padding and mark the boxes as fragile.

For clothing, use wardrobe boxes to keep garments on hangers. It saves time during both packing and unpacking. Electronics should be packed in their original boxes if available, or well-padded in strong boxes.

Addressing Utilities and Services

Approximately 4-6 weeks before your move, contact utility companies to schedule the disconnection of services at your old address and reconnection at the new one. This includes electricity, water, gas, internet, and cable.

Notify other service providers and institutions of your change of address. This includes banks, insurance companies, and subscription services. Update your address with the post office to forward any mail.

Additionally, ensure that the new home utilities will be activated before your arrival. This prevents any inconvenience upon moving in and allows for a more comfortable transition.

Final Home Walk-Through

Before leaving, it’s crucial to perform a thorough check of every room.

Ensure cabinets, closets, and drawers are empty. Verify that windows are closed and locked, and all lights and appliances are turned off. Confirm that you’re leaving behind any agreed-upon items, such as fixtures or appliances.

Take pictures of the empty home. They serve as evidence of its condition when you left. Make sure you also collect keys, garage door openers, and any security codes to hand over to the new owners or the real estate agent.

Essential Items and Personal Survival Kit

Pack a "go" bag with vital items to keep you comfortable and organized on moving day.

Include essentials like your wallet, keys, phone, and chargers. Bring medications, basic toiletries, and a change of clothes. Non-perishable snacks and drinks are helpful to maintain energy levels.

Have important documents, such as identification, contracts, and medical records, within easy reach. For those with pets or children, pack their necessities to ensure they remain comfortable. Don’t forget a basic toolkit for minor adjustments and repairs.

Standing Desks

Standing desks are beneficial for reducing the amount of time spent sitting. They allow employees to alternate between sitting and standing throughout the day, which can improve posture and increase energy levels. By standing for part of the day, you can burn more calories and reduce the risk of health issues linked to prolonged sitting.

Some desks are adjustable, making it easy to switch between sitting and standing. Consider setting reminders to stand up every hour. Pairing a standing desk with an anti-fatigue mat can also reduce strain on your feet and legs.

Active Breaks

Taking short, active breaks throughout the workday can make a significant difference in overall activity levels. Simple activities like stretching, walking around the office, or doing light exercises such as lunges or squats can help reduce stiffness and improve circulation.

These breaks don't need to be long; even five minutes can boost energy and focus. Encourage a culture of movement by suggesting team activities or setting up a walking club. Using reminders or apps to prompt breaks can also ensure consistency.

Office Layout Modification

Modifying the office layout can promote more movement naturally. Placing printers, trash bins, and other commonly used items farther from desks encourages walking. Creating open spaces for stretching or small-group exercises can also be beneficial.

Design pathways that encourage walking and some open areas where employees can do light exercises. Another idea is to use standing or walking meetings. These simple modifications can create a work environment that prioritizes physical activity and wellness.

Evaluating Professional Packing Services

When contemplating a move, homeowners may weigh the pros and cons of employing professional movers for packing services. One of the key considerations is time efficiency. Professional movers are trained to pack quickly and competently. A typical three-bedroom house may take professionals a few hours to a full day to pack, significantly faster than the average homeowner. For larger homes, such as those with four or more bedrooms, the time naturally extends, possibly ranging from 4 to 6 days.

The following table presents a general overview of the estimated time professionals may require to pack various home sizes:

Home SizeEstimated Professional Packing Time
Studio2-3 Hours
1-Bedroom Home1-2 Days
2-Bedroom Home2-3 Days
3-Bedroom Home3-5 Days
4-Bedroom Home4-6 Days
5-Bedroom Home7 Days (1 Week)

Professional packing also brings with it quality assurance; items are less likely to be damaged in transit due to the packers' expertise and use of appropriate packing materials.

Financial Advantages

Increased Home Value: One key advantage of moving homes is the potential for purchasing a property that will appreciate over time. Despite market fluctuations, residential real estate tends to rise in value over the long term. For example, barring economic downturns like the 2008 Housing Crash, median home prices generally experience an upward trend.

Employment Opportunities: Relocating can also open doors to better job prospects and potentially higher income. A move motivated by a job change may lead to a financial uplift if the new position offers a more favorable compensation package or if the cost of living in the new area is lower.

Economic Drawbacks

Relocation Expenses: The costs associated with moving can be substantial. Expenses often range from hundreds to thousands of dollars, depending on the distance and logistics involved. This can include the cost of professional movers, transportation, and time taken off from work to facilitate the move.

Market Risks: There’s always a risk that the housing market could face a downturn, leading to depreciation in property values. Homeowners must be mindful of the risk of market volatility affecting the financial benefits they anticipate from their investment in a new property.

UNPACKING AND DECORATING

Unpacking should start with the essentials. One should target the bathroom and kitchen items first for immediate functionality. Breakables must be handled with care—unpack these items over a padded surface.

Decorating is the next step, which personalizes the space and makes it feel more like home. Lightweight artwork and removable sticky hooks can offer a no-damage solution for renters. It's critical to respect the landlord's property to avoid potential damage fees.

GETTING ACQUAINTED WITH YOUR NEW HOME

Becoming familiar with the new living environment is essential for a smooth transition. Locate the emergency exits, understand the trash disposal system, and identify the main water shut-off valve. It's also prudent to introduce oneself to neighbors and learn about the community norms.
